William E Schrafft and Bertha E Schrafft Charitable Trust
The William E Schrafft and Bertha E Schrafft Charitable Trust is a private family foundation established in 1946 in Massachusetts. Based in Boston, the Trust is a 501(c)(3) organization committed to supporting nonprofit organizations that serve underserved youth and populations in Massachusetts, with particular emphasis on the cities of Boston and New Bedford.

Mission & Focus Areas
The Trust is committed to the intellectual, personal, and artistic growth of underserved youth ages 6-21, primarily through supporting neighborhood-based education programming throughout Boston. The Trust also maintains a special interest in building effective pathways to economic independence for underserved populations in New Bedford through education, entrepreneurship, and economic development.
The Trust supports efforts that help young people develop the skills and knowledge needed to succeed in school and lay the foundation for satisfying and productive lives.
Funding Priorities:
- Youth development and academic enrichment programming
- Arts and culture programming for underserved populations
- Out-of-school programming (after-school, evenings, weekends, and summers)
- Programs demonstrating caring, consistent, long-term relationships between young people and organization staff or volunteers
- High-quality educational, developmental, artistic, and recreational opportunities
- Organizations in New Bedford that leverage regional strengths (people, culture, history, agriculture, fishing, and seacoast resources) to provide pathways to economic independence
Grantmaking
The Trust does not provide grants for capital expenditures or scholarships.

Financial History
Multi-year comparison from IRS filings
As of 2024:
- Total Assets: $47,553,512
- Total Revenues: $16,468,761
- Total Expenses: $2,755,465
As of 2023:
- Total Assets: $44,500,000
- Total Revenues: $1,910,000
- Total Expenses: $2,520,000
| Metric |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Assets | $47,553,512 | $44,500,085 | $41,877,533 |
| Revenue | $16,468,761 | $1,908,228 | $1,849,069 |
| Expenses | $2,755,465 | $2,516,734 | $2,409,204 |
| Qualifying Distributions | $2,200,289 | $2,066,000 | $2,035,600 |
| Net Investment Income | $16,228,854 | $1,572,338 | $1,571,832 |
| Distributable Amount | $2,078,805 | $2,097,869 | $2,184,045 |
